A 21-year-old girl named Nikitha became the Sarpanch of her village in Telangana.

She is also studying to be a doctor.

Nikitha won the election as a Congress candidate and wants to make her village better.

She plans to bring a bus service, fix the drains, and improve the water supply.

She also wants to set up a school for soldiers' children.

Nikitha is very young to be a Sarpanch, and people are happy with her because she is honest and cares about her village.

She will also organize health camps to teach people about diseases like malaria and dengue.

Quotes

Kavali Nikitha

21-year-old MBBS student and newly elected Sarpanch of Shakhapur (Y) village

“I did not think I would come this far, so any opportunity given to me, I will prove myself. As a medico, I will also conduct health camps and awareness programmes on malaria, dengue and other issues. I thank Wanaparthy MLA Megha Reddy and MP Mallu Ravi.”
deccanchronicle.com
“Our village has problems with the drainage system and drinking water pipeline connections. I want to fix them. I have support from my professors and college, so I will balance my Sarpanch role and my studies.”
